Storage of Information. Information about you may be stored physically or electronically, including in offshore facilities, by BNZ, any other BNZ Company or any third party (who is subject to an obligation of confidentiality in relation to that information) contracted to store it. Each BNZ Company will ensure that any information held about you is protected securely by safeguards as required by the Privacy Act 1993 and any other applicable laws. No BNZ Company will disclose information about you to any person, except in connection with a purpose described below, or as authorised by you or as required or authorised by law.
